Aspose.Cells API 使用指南:工作簿操作与属性解析
4星 · 超过85%的资源 需积分: 0 47 浏览量
更新于2024-07-24
2
收藏 1.48MB DOC 举报
"aspose 中文api"
Aspose 是一个强大的文件处理库,尤其在处理Microsoft Office格式如Excel、Word和PDF时,它提供了丰富的API功能。对于Aspose.Cells,它是Aspose产品系列中专门用于处理电子表格的部分。这个库允许开发者在没有安装Microsoft Excel的情况下,对Excel文件进行创建、读取、修改和转换。Aspose.Cells支持多种编程语言,包括.NET、Java、Python等。
在描述中提到的"Workbook"是Aspose.Cells中的核心类,代表了一个Excel工作簿对象。以下是一些关于Workbook类的重要属性和事件的详细说明:
1. **属性**:
- **Colors**: 这是一个Color数组,用于获取或设置Excel工作簿中可用的颜色。
- **ConvertNumericData**: 如果设置为true(默认),Aspose.Cells会尝试将字符串转换为数字数据。
- **DataSorter**: 提供数据排序功能,可以对工作表中的数据进行排序。
- **Date1904**: 如果为true,表示工作簿使用1904日期系统,这是Excel的一种日期计算方式。
- **DefaultStyle**: 获取或设置工作簿的默认样式,应用于新单元格或新工作表。
- **HasMacro**: 检查工作簿是否包含宏或宏指令。
- **IsHScrollBarVisible** 和 **IsVScrollBarVisible**: 控制工作簿视图中行和列的滚动条是否可见。
- **Language** 和 **Region**: 分别设置工作簿的语言和区域设置,可以影响日期、货币等格式。
- **Password**: 设置工作簿的打开密码,实现保护。
- **ReCalcOnOpen**: 若为true,工作簿打开时会重新计算所有公式。
- **Shared**: 表示工作簿是否被共享,可能涉及多个用户同时编辑。
- **ShowTabs**: 控制是否显示工作表标签,默认为可见。
- **Styles**: 存储工作簿的所有样式,可以创建、修改和应用样式。
- **Worksheets**: 包含工作簿中的所有工作表。
2. **事件**:
- **CalculateFormula**: 当计算公式时触发,可以忽略错误或自定义函数。
- 参数:`ignoreError` 决定是否忽略计算错误,`customFunction` 允许自定义函数处理。
这些属性和事件提供了一套完整的工具,使得开发者能够深入控制Excel文件的各个方面,例如调整样式、处理数据、添加宏、应用排序规则等。通过Aspose.Cells的API,你可以创建复杂的电子表格程序,进行数据处理、分析,甚至实现自动化的工作流程。
使用Aspose.Cells,开发人员可以轻松地进行单元格操作、公式计算、图表创建、图像插入、数据验证等各种功能。此外,还可以导出Excel文件到其他格式,如PDF、HTML、CSV等,或者将其他格式的数据导入到Excel中。Aspose.Cells是一个功能强大的库,为开发者提供了无与伦比的Excel文件处理能力。
2024-01-04 上传
2018-12-05 上传
2020-03-10 上传
2020-03-09 上传
点击了解资源详情
2019-05-23 上传
dralion
- 粉丝: 3
- 资源: 11
最新资源
- C语言数组操作:高度检查器编程实践
- 基于Swift开发的嘉定单车LBS iOS应用项目解析
- 钗头凤声乐表演的二度创作分析报告
- 分布式数据库特训营全套教程资料
- JavaScript开发者Robert Bindar的博客平台
- MATLAB投影寻踪代码教程及文件解压缩指南
- HTML5拖放实现的RPSLS游戏教程
- HT://Dig引擎接口,Ampoliros开源模块应用
- 全面探测服务器性能与PHP环境的iprober PHP探针v0.024
- 新版提醒应用v2:基于MongoDB的数据存储
- 《我的世界》东方大陆1.12.2材质包深度体验
- Hypercore Promisifier: JavaScript中的回调转换为Promise包装器
- 探索开源项目Artifice:Slyme脚本与技巧游戏
- Matlab机器人学习代码解析与笔记分享
- 查尔默斯大学计算物理作业HP2解析
- GitHub问题管理新工具:GIRA-crx插件介绍